Zemětice
Zemětice is a municipality and village in Plzeň-South District in the Plzeň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 300 inhabitants.

Zemětice lies approximately 24 kilometres (15 mi) south-west of Plzeň and 106 km (66 mi) south-west of Prague.
Administrative parts
Villages of Čelákovy and Chalupy are administrative parts of Zemětice.
